A day shaped by nature and movement
Leaving Melbourne, the journey heads toward Phillip Island with relaxed pacing and local commentary focused on wildlife, coastal landscapes, and conservation rather than scripted facts.
Koalas in the wild
Koala Conservation Reserve
Begin with a peaceful walk through eucalyptus woodland on elevated boardwalks, where koalas can be seen resting, feeding, and moving freely in their natural habitat.
Your entry ticket is included, and the experience prioritizes quiet observation and animal welfare.
Free time for lunch in Cowes
Stop in Cowes, Phillip Island’s main township, with time to choose your own lunch.
Lunch is not included by design, allowing flexibility for different dietary needs, preferences, and cultural beliefs. Cafes, bakeries, and takeaway options are available.
Cape Woolamai coastal hike (4.9 km)
This is what makes the tour truly different.
Enjoy a 4.9 km coastal hike at Cape Woolamai, following clifftop trails with sweeping ocean views, rugged rock formations, and abundant birdlife. The hike is paced for enjoyment rather than speed, with time for photos, rest, and appreciation of the landscape.
This active element transforms the day from a sightseeing tour into a genuine coastal adventure.
The Nobbies coastal boardwalk
Continue to The Nobbies, where boardwalks stretch above crashing waves and rocky headlands. Learn about local marine life, seabirds, and the powerful Southern Ocean that shapes this coastline.
Penguin Parade at sunset
End the day with the world-famous Phillip Island Penguin Parade.
Watch little penguins emerge from the ocean and waddle back to their burrows at sunset. Your entry ticket is included, and the experience follows strict guidelines to ensure penguin protection and minimal disturbance.

Important Information
- Phillip Island faces the Southern Ocean, with weather influenced by Antarctic conditions. It can become cold and windy, especially after sunset. A warm jacket is essential.
